开发环境下,如何测试消息中心的投放类消息
开发环境下,希望测试消息中心的投放类消息是否能够正常显示,该如何操作?
发布时间: 2018-11-16 19:05
回答:
在开发环境下进行投放类消息测试时,方法如下:
我们以福利红包消息作为测试例子,来进行接口调试。
获取消息中心管理平台所预置的投放类消息信息。
找到福利红包消息对应的消息信息。
在我们准备的范例中,福利红包消息信息如下:
RC:ML:Welfare:RedPacket
{
"imageUrl":"https://rongcloud-res.cn.ronghub.com/571007975012bddce50b1ae9f9016032",
"content":"红包袭来,快来试试手气",
"contentUrl":"http://www.rongcloud.cn",
"extra":""
}
pushContent:红包袭来
确认福利红包消息在移动客户端的消息中心属于哪个消息分类,并确认在配置文件中,此分类的 id。
在我们准备的范例中,福利红包消息所对应的消息分类 id 为:rong_system_event
"h-users": [ { "id": "rong_system_trading", "name": "交易信息", "portrait": "https://rongcloud-res.cn.ronghub.com/6fb522d997abb6e7fda21b090593b8a6" }, { "id": "rong_system_notice", "name": "系统通知", "portrait": "https://rongcloud-res.cn.ronghub.com/029050d88b0d75a3507550eaf7ce63ed" }, { "id": "rong_system_event", "name": "活动福利", "portrait": "https://rongcloud-res.cn.ronghub.com/125c94ebe629dc0b539f2126f01a105b" } ], "v-users": [ { "id": "rong_system_community", "name": "社区消息", "portrait": "https://rongcloud-res.cn.ronghub.com/381b9fe0009d146035d6356e30cd2a4a" }, { "id": "rong_system_interaction", "name": "互动消息", "portrait": "https://rongcloud-res.cn.ronghub.com/808ce1ebad4aba400491ce0005ea75de" } ], "display-friends": true }
确认用于测试的移动端所对应的 userid。
在我们准备的范例中,林泽华的 userid 为:MCTester
进入开发者平台的 API 调用页面,选择“广播推送服务”,点击“广播消息(可按机型、标签、用户发送)”。
根据以上准备好的信息,进行 Server API 调试。
点击提交,查看执行结果。
在用于测试的移动客户端查看是否接收到投放的消息。